The lymphatic system operates as the body’s secondary circulatory network, managing fluid balance, filtering pathogens, and facilitating immune cell transport. Individuals with specific medical conditions, such as active thrombosis or severe cardiovascular issues, should consult a healthcare provider before beginning any new lymphatic support regimen.
